SK Somaiya College does not mention any fixed percentage to get admission in the BSc program. All it says is that the candidate should have passed 10+2 or equivalent in any stream with Mathematics as one of its subjects. The detailed SK Somaiya BSc eligibility criteria as released by the institute are as follows
The candidate must have passed the Higher Secondary School Certificate Examination conducted by the Maharashtra State Board of Secondary and Higher Secondary Education, in the following subjects:

I am a fourth year B.Tech CSE student at IIT Bhubaneswar. As per the NIRF Engineering Ranking 2023, IIT Bhubaneswar is placed 47th. Moreover, IIT Bhubaneswar recorded 100% placements in B.Tech CSE in 2023, and the average package stood at INR 25.18 LPA for this branch. The top recruiters at IIT Bhubaneswar for 2023 placements were- Accenture, Adobe, Amazon, Dell, Deloitte, HCL, Infosys, ISRO, among others.
Here are the 2023 placement statistics for B.Tech CSE at IIT Bhubaneswar:
| Particulars | Placement (2023) |
|---|---|
| Average Salary | INR 25.18 LPA |
| Highest Salary | INR 55.75 LPA |
| Median Salary | INR 20.31 LPA |
| Lowest Salary | INR 9 LPA |
| % Batch placed | 100 |
Other than performing well in placements, the students of B.Tech CSE at IIT Bhubaneswar get to be a part of various interesting clubs and societies. These are- The Robotics and Intelligent Systems Club (RISC), Web and Design Society (WebnD), and Neuromancers (The Programming Society).
These clubs and societies allow students to indulge in the fields of robotics, web development and programming by interacting with others and working on interesting projects.

When it comes to MNC at IIT Kharagpur, the course is primarily focused on Mathematics, while only a small portion is related to coding or computer sciences. However, this can actually work to your advantage because the course structure of MNC department at IIT Kgp offers you an equal opportunity to enhance your skills in coding as well as in Finance or Analytics.
Moreover, if you happen to fall in love with your course, you also have the opportunity to pursue a Phd in Applied Mathematics as you will be graduating with an MSc degree.
